Simple Fixes for iPhone Home Screen Black
Force Restart Your iPhone
This clears temporary glitches like magic.
Force Restart for Face ID Models
-
Press and release Volume Up
-
Press and release Volume Down
-
Hold the Side button until the Apple logo appears
Force Restart for Home Button Models
Hold the Home button and Power button together until you see the Apple logo.
Lock and Unlock Trick
Sometimes locking the phone and unlocking it after a few seconds resets the home screen display.

Reset All Settings
This won’t delete data, but it resets system settings.
Go to:
Settings → General → Transfer or Reset iPhone → Reset → Reset All Settings

OLED Screens and Battery Saving
On OLED iPhones, black pixels are literally turned off. That means real battery savings.
How to Set a Pure Black Wallpaper
Use a true black image (#000000) from Photos or Wallpaper settings for maximum effect.

Accessibility Settings That Affect Screen Appearance
Reduce White Point
This lowers brightness intensity and can make the screen look darker than expected.
Zoom and Display Filters
Display filters or zoom can cause weird visual behavior if misconfigured.
Invert Colors
Color inversion can turn normal colors into confusing dark layouts.
